    My immediate reaction to stumbling upon this pub went something along the lines of... 'What the frak - how did they hide a giant-ass big ol' mother of an outdoor patio here?!' To be fair, I didn't really say that out loud, but it was amongst some of the more colourful inner monologue I'd had with myself that day. And though I can't speak to the food from first-hand experience, I can say that the burger in particular looked massive and mouthwatering. Instead, I downed a pint or two of Blue Moon (on draught, no less) and enjoyed being outdoors during the brief London summer days. Though there's more outdoor seating than you'd find virtually anywhere else around these parts, you'll still having to be somewhat cut-throat in order to grab yourself a table on a nice evening. However, it can be done... and it's wholeheartedly worth it!

    I think the Highgate Inn is best described by what you can find inside. You get all the necessities…read morefor both casual and committed drinker alike, fruit machines, heavy oak tables and even the unbalanced bar stools but that is just the tip of the proverbial iceberg. This pub seems to have all the little extras that make a great pub. For a start the Juke Box (something which you really don't find in enough pubs) has an amazing array of songs, from the popular to the obscure allowing you to adjust the backing tracks to your night accordingly (although I did get some dirty looks when I put on 5 James bond themes in a row). The sofas (found to the rear of the bar) are incredibly comfortable and very easy to get enveloped by, I would recommend heading to the Highgate inn for these alone, the beer access is a plus. If that isn't for you there are plenty of normal seats and even the option to stand if you would like. In terms of drinks the array on offer is diverse (not ground breaking but certainly not dull). On occasion you may see the odd alcohol dispensing nick knack behind the bar (I once witnessed a bottle holster that caused a desperado bottle to float in mid air). Little props like a frog fountain that spews fog, 4-5 ft tall wooden horses and the occasional seal teddy hanging from the many abstract paintings create a hint of a quirky atmosphere without making that the theme of the pub. Should you feel the need to smoke you will be forced into the street but before you hit the pavement you can take refuge in the outside chairs complete with matching tables, not the best in the winter but better than having to dodge pedestrians. All in all this is a very under attended pub. The staff are helpful and polite, the locals and newcomers seem to get along well and the atmosphere is on par with most of the other pubs in Highgate (better than some).

    A decent 'old school' pub on Archway road a bit further on from the Woodman as you head up the hill…read morefrom the station. Inside you find lots of beams and dark wood, fruit machines, TV's for sport and plenty of seating dotted around including some sofas. It's all a bit mismatched and thrown together the way a pub should be. It reminded me of being in a little out of the way place in some village somewhere where the pretentiousness of London had passed by unnoticed. The beer on offer was ok, my London pride was pretty good although nothing special but for me the appeal of this place is the ease of getting a seat compared to the Woodman, the fact inside it's like pubs used to be before they all became identikit carbon copies of one another selling overpriced dismal food and trying too hard to be the next big foodie destination.
